
CBL game recaps
July 28, 2005 - Central Baseball League (Central League) News Release
SHREVEPORT 7, SAN ANGELO 0 @ Shreveport, La. Time: 2:16 ATT: 1,460 W: Eric Wikstrom (5-5) L: Joldy Watts (5-9) S: None HR: SHR - Hector Lebron (4) Shreveport scored three in the first and two in the second, more than enough for starter Eric Wikstrom, who went the distance, allowing eight hits but no runs and striking out six in the full nine innings. Joldy Watts took the loss for the Colts, allowing eleven hits and seven runs, six earned, in seven innings of work. DH Chad Gambill was 3-for-4, scoring twice and driving in one, and SS Enohel Polanco also had three hits with a pair of RBIs for the Sports. 1B Hector Lebron drove in two with a second inning home run. Leadoff man and 2B John Anderson had three hits for San Angelo in the losing effort. ----------------------------------------------------------------------- JACKSON 5, EDINBURG 4 @ Jackson, Miss. Time: 2:41 ATT: 818 W: Brandon Parker (4-2) L: Carlos Figueroa (0-1) S: None HR: Jared Boyd (3) The Senators and Roadrunners fought to the finish in Jackson, with Edinburg battling to overcome a 4-1 deficit only to fall by one run in the bottom of the ninth. The Roadrunners struck first with a run in the opening inning, but the Senators tied the game in the fourth and put up three in the sixth. Edinburg answered with a run in the seventh and two in the eighth to tie, but LF Selwyn Langaigne doubled home CF Nick Sorensen in the bottom of the ninth off Roadrunner reliever Carlos Figueroa to put the game away for Jackson. Sorensen, 1B Josh Tranum and SS Edgar Tovar all had three-hit nights for Jackson, who pounded out 14 as a team. ----------------------------------------------------------------------- PENSACOLA 5, COASTAL BEND 4 @ Robstown, Texas. Time: 3:09 ATT: 2,097 W: Josh Courage (4-2) L: J.J. Trujillo (4-8) S: Edwar Ramirez (6) HR: PEN - Juan Rocha (18) CB - Mike Guerrero (7) Coastal Bend tied a 4-1 game in the fifth inning only to see Pensacola score to go ahead in the top of the seventh and hold the lead to beat the Aviators in Robstown. 2B Kenny Hansley and LF Kevin Henry drove in the fifth-inning runs for the Aviators with singles, but the defense contributed to the Pelicans eventual winning run two innings later. 2B Carlos Mendoza led off the seventh with a single and stole second. SS Joe Espada put down a bunt to sacrifice but ended up on second base when P J.J. Trujillo attempted the play on Mendoza at third and threw the ball away, allowing him to score. Henry was 2-for-4 with a pair driven in and 1B Mike Guerrero had three hits, including a homer, for the Aviators. ----------------------------------------------------------------------- EL PASO 4, FORT WORTH 3 (10) @ El Paso, Texas. Time: 2:46 ATT: 2,880 W: Derrick DePriest (5-4) L: Ray Beasley (2-3) S: None HR: None Fort Worth scored three in the first and ended the game with 13 hits, but Diablos starter Hisazumi Ide along with relievers Alexis Guzman and Derrick DePriest held the Cats scoreless from the second on while the offense chipped away at the lead with single runs in the first, sixth and eighth before winning it in the tenth. DH John Allen was 3-for-5 for the Cats, while LF Tony Mota, CF Carlos Adolfo and 1B Jordan Foster contributed two apiece. RF Carlos Sepulveda led the way for the Diablos, going 3-for-5 with an RBI and two runs scored while 1B Juan Camacho had two doubles and one batted in.
